Although a bit “touristy” due to its historical nature, many locals still frequent Place des Vosges for the simple beauty and charm of the park and surrounding architecture. I was lucky enough to get this shot just minutes before an absolute downpour of rain that drove everyone away in an instant. I almost didn’t make it out myself, as I was trying to protect my equipment before it rolled through…made it out with literally seconds to spare!
